What went wrong:
A problem occurred configuring root project 'android'
Could not resolve all artifacts for configuration
":classpath
Could not find com.android.tools.build:gradle:6.7.
Searched in the following locations:
-nttps:1/dl.google.com/d/android/maven2/com/android/tools/build/aradle/6.7/gradle-6.7.pom
nttps://repo_naven_apache.org/maven2/com/android/tools/build/aradle/6.7/gradle-6.7.pom
Required by:
project
Related
I have tried to solve it through different pre-answered questions on StackOverflow but they are not working, That is why asking here, Please help.
here is the problem:
FAILURE: Build failed with an exception.
* Where:
Build file 'C:\Users\TME_Education\StudioProjects\jeda\android\app\build.gradle' line: 58
* What went wrong:
A problem occurred evaluating project ':app'.
> Could not find method compile() for arguments [com.android.tools.build:gradle:7.1.2] on object of type org.gradle.api.internal.artifacts.dsl.dependencies.DefaultDependencyHandler.
Here is my dependency
dependencies {
compile 'com.android.tools.build:gradle:7.1.2'
implementation "org.jetbrains.kotlin:kotlin-stdlib-jdk7:$kotlin_version"
}
I was runing the code but this gradle Dependency eror happened.
I was trying to use this dependency but the problem is that my terminal couldn't access the directory due to my user name. I have a school organization account, and after the name it has a "(St" after my name. I tried to cd into that directory but it tells me that is requires a "close parentheses" or ")". How can I fix this?
FAILURE: Build failed with an exception.
What went wrong:
A problem occurred configuring project ':shared_preferences_android'.
Could not resolve all dependencies for configuration ':shared_preferences_android:classpath'.
Could not load module metadata from C:\Users\BoneteJobertJanne(St.gradle\caches\modules-2\metadata-2.97\descriptors\org.jetbrains.kotlin\kotlin-reflect\1.5.31\a8be1fe3b3911d3d3425fe720cf42835\descriptor.bin
Failed to notify project evaluation listener.
Could not get unknown property 'android' for project ':shared_preferences_android' of type org.gradle.api.Project.
Could not get unknown property 'android' for project ':shared_preferences_android' of type org.gradle.api.Project.
Installed an app from git-hub to update it, using flutter 1.22.6 (because the app was built using this version) but facing this error when running the code.
FAILURE: Build failed with an exception.
What went wrong:
Could not determine the dependencies of task ':app:compileDebugJavaWithJavac'.
Could not resolve all task dependencies for configuration ':app:debugCompileClasspath'.
Could not resolve com.google.firebase:firebase-messaging:[10.2.1, 17.3.99].
Required by:
project :app > com.onesignal:OneSignal:3.15.6
> Failed to list versions for com.google.firebase:firebase-messaging.
> Unable to load Maven meta-data from https://google.bintray.com/exoplayer/com/google/firebase/firebase-messaging/maven-metadata.xml.
> Could not get resource 'https://google.bintray.com/exoplayer/com/google/firebase/firebase-messaging/maven-metadata.xml'.
> Could not GET 'https://google.bintray.com/exoplayer/com/google/firebase/firebase-messaging/maven-metadata.xml'. Received status code 403 from server: Forbidden
Could not resolve com.google.android.gms:play-services-ads-identifier:[15.0.0, 16.0.99].
Required by:
project :app > com.onesignal:OneSignal:3.15.6
> Failed to list versions for com.google.android.gms:play-services-ads-identifier.
> Unable to load Maven meta-data from https://google.bintray.com/exoplayer/com/google/android/gms/play-services-ads-identifier/maven-metadata.xml.
> Could not get resource 'https://google.bintray.com/exoplayer/com/google/android/gms/play-services-ads-identifier/maven-metadata.xml'.
> Could not GET 'https://google.bintray.com/exoplayer/com/google/android/gms/play-services-ads-identifier/maven-metadata.xml'. Received status code 403 from server: Forbidd
en
Could not resolve com.google.android.gms:play-services-base:[10.2.1, 16.1.99].
Required by:
project :app > com.onesignal:OneSignal:3.15.6
> Failed to list versions for com.google.android.gms:play-services-base.
> Unable to load Maven meta-data from https://google.bintray.com/exoplayer/com/google/android/gms/play-services-base/maven-metadata.xml.
> Could not get resource 'https://google.bintray.com/exoplayer/com/google/android/gms/play-services-base/maven-metadata.xml'.
> Could not GET 'https://google.bintray.com/exoplayer/com/google/android/gms/play-services-base/maven-metadata.xml'. Received status code 403 from server: Forbidden
because your project has old dependencies I suggest doing a Flutter clean.
but the error says that you don't have permission to download from the link. I think connect to VPN should solve this issue
For error related to 4XX, replace jcenter() with mavenCentral() in build.gradle file.
repositories {
google()
jcenter() //remove this
mavenCentral() //add this
}
What went wrong:
Could not determine the dependencies of task ':app:preDebugBuild'.
Could not resolve all task dependencies for configuration ':app:debugRuntimeClasspath'.
Could not resolve project :path_provider_macos.
Required by:
project :app > project :path_provider
Unable to find a matching configuration of project :path_provider_macos: None of the consumable configurations have attributes.
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.
Get more help at https://help.gradle.org
BUILD FAILED in 2s
Finished with error: Gradle task assembleDebug failed with exit code 1
Some imports are missing. Try flutter pub get to update packages, or flutter pub cache repair, which will re-import all dependencies.
thank everyone , i get the solution about my problem : go to your Flutter sdk folder ,then go to .pub-cache\hosted\pub.dartlang.org\ ,if there have a path_provider_macos-0.0.4 folder ,delete it ,if no ,you try go .pub-cache\hosted\pub.flutter-io.cn\ , and remove path_provider_macos-0.0.4 folder
Deleted the folder you said,but show this wrong : Project :flutter declares a dependency from configuration 'embed' to configuration 'default' which is not declared in the descriptor for project :path_provider_macos.
The following is detailed:
> A problem occurred configuring project ':flutter'.
> Could not resolve all dependencies for configuration ':flutter:embed'.
> Could not resolve project :path_provider_macos.
Required by:
project :flutter
> Project :flutter declares a dependency from configuration 'embed' to configuration 'default' which is not declared in the descriptor for project :path_provider_macos.
> Could not resolve project :path_provider_linux.
Required by:
project :flutter
> Project :flutter declares a dependency from configuration 'embed' to configuration 'default' which is not declared in the descriptor for project :path_provider_linux.
What went wrong: Could not determine the dependencies of task
':app:compileDebugJavaWithJavac'. > Could not resolve all task
dependencies for configuration ':app:debugCompileClasspath'. > Could
not find
io.flutter:flutter_embedding_debug:1.0.0-e1e6ced81d029258d449bdec2ba3cddca9c2ca0c.
Required by: project :app > Could not find
io.flutter:x86_debug:1.0.0-e1e6ced81d029258d449bdec2ba3cddca9c2ca0c.
Required by: project :app > Could not find
io.flutter:x86_64_debug:1.0.0-e1e6ced81d029258d449bdec2ba3cddca9c2ca0c.
Required by: project :ap
Make sure you're on master branch and your flutter upgraded to last version.
then if the error remain delete the .gradle cache folder in youre home and applying ./gradlew cleanBuildCache in the project's android sub directory.